State of Tennessee v. James Robert Howell

Case Number
E2024-00961-CCA-R3-CD

A Knox County jury convicted the defendant, James Robert Howell, of four counts of
sexual battery by an authority figure and one count of assault by offensive or provocative
touching, for which he received an effective sentence of four years and six months in
confinement. On appeal, the defendant contends the evidence presented at trial was
insufficient to support his convictions. The defendant also contends that the trial court
erred in admitting hearsay evidence, in admitting evidence of prior abuse, and in imposing
an excessive sentence. Additionally, the defendant claims improper argument by the State
affected the verdict. After reviewing the record and considering the applicable law, we
affirm the judgments of the trial court.
